We have to open our hearts and let God use us! We can stand back and build walls to be comfortable but you will feel trapped in those walls at the same time. You might not see that the walls are trapping you. You might make yourself think that it is something else that makes you feel trapped.
Example: Your job, your relationships, your organizational skills, where you live, how much you get paid, what your boss thinks of you, what town you live in, what your friends think of you, your own lusts, how your parents raised you and even the way you are raising your kids(mentoring someone if you don't have kids yet).
These are things that we add to our walls. All of those things are like posters and stickers hiding the walls we built so that God and others can't get too close. To break those walls you don't have to do it brick by brick(that's not a bad place to start though) but you can kick it down. Yes, you might feel vulnerable but God is standing next to you. Things might tempt you to started building those walls again but He is there to hold back the main force of satan, only letting enough temptation through for you to fight along side God. You can ask for the strength to fight the temptation and He will give it to you.
You must know that it wont be an easy road though. It will be hard at times but those times are the times where God is watching for you to shine and deny the devil and praise the Lord. The more you fight the easier it will be to fight that temptation. Though you will start having things thrown at you that you would have never been able to fight before but because you have been faithful, God knows you will rely on Him. He lets us go through stuff that we never dreamed of because he knows you and your love for Him and he wants to see how much we will fight for him.
You are thinking why would i want to put myself through all that. Well let me just tell you. God will bless you in many different ways after each temptation overcome. He will see that you want to be closer to him more and more. You might not see every blessing but one thing i can say is that if you are asking for Gods help you will feel so much peace. My brothers kick down that wall and remember: James 1:2-4(NKJV)
2 My brethren, count it all joy when you fall into various trials, 3 knowing that the testing of your faith produces patience. 4 But let patience have its perfect work, that you may be perfect and complete, lacking nothing.

VOW = Verse Of the Week
Isaiah 50:4 -
The Lord God has given Me the tongue of disciples, that I may know how to sustain the weary one with a word. He awakens Me morning by morning, He awakens My ear to listen as a disciple. - Isaiah 50:4
Let's memorize this verse together and say it next week to each other.
We are called to be like Jesus. We should get up early morning by morning and listen as a disciple and be one. (I'm speaking to myself MORE than to any of all men. I need to allow myself to be woken by God and to get into His word.)
